hu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]Kali Linux数据库评估,安全与性能的双重保障|kali linux使用手册,Kali Linux数据库评估

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

Kali Linux是款专为安全测试设计的操作系统,其数据库评估功能强大,能全面检测数据库安全性及性能。通过内置工具,Kali Linux可识别漏洞、优化配置,确保数据安全与高效运行。本文将详解Kali Linux数据库评估方法,涵盖安全检测、性能调优等关键步骤,为用户提供双重保障。掌握这些技巧,可有效提升数据库整体防护水平,保障信息安全。

本文目录导读:

  1. Kali Linux简介
  2. 数据库评估的重要性
  3. Kali Linux在数据库评估中的应用
  4. 数据库评估的步骤
  5. 最佳实践
  6. 案例分析

在当今信息化的时代,数据库作为存储和管理数据的核心组件,其安全性和性能直接关系到企业的运营和发展,Kali Linux作为一款专为安全测试和渗透测试设计的操作系统,提供了丰富的工具和资源,帮助用户进行全面的数据库评估,本文将深入探讨Kali Linux在数据库评估中的应用,涵盖安全性检测、性能优化以及最佳实践等方面。

Kali Linux简介

Kali Linux是由Offensive Security Ltd.维护和发布的一款基于Debian的Linux发行版,专为数字取证和渗透测试而设计,它集成了大量安全研究人员和网络黑客常用的工具,涵盖了信息收集、漏洞扫描、密码破解、无线攻击等多个领域。

数据库评估的重要性

数据库评估是确保数据库安全性和性能的关键步骤,通过评估,可以发现潜在的安全漏洞、性能瓶颈以及配置不当等问题,从而采取相应的措施进行修复和优化,数据库评估主要包括以下几个方面:

1、安全性评估:检测数据库是否存在已知的安全漏洞,验证用户权限和访问控制是否合理。

2、性能评估:分析数据库的响应时间、吞吐量等性能指标,找出性能瓶颈。

3、配置评估:检查数据库的配置参数是否合理,是否符合最佳实践。

Kali Linux在数据库评估中的应用

Kali Linux提供了多种工具和资源,帮助用户进行全面的数据库评估,以下是一些常用的工具和方法:

1. 安全性评估工具

SQLMap:一款自动化的SQL注入和数据库接管工具,可以检测和利用SQL注入漏洞。

Nmap:网络扫描工具,可以用于发现网络中的数据库服务器,并识别其版本和开放端口。

Metasploit:一款强大的渗透测试框架,包含大量针对数据库的攻击模块。

2. 性能评估工具

MySQLtuner:一款针对MySQL数据库的性能调优工具,可以提供优化建议。

pgBadger:PostgreSQL日志分析工具,可以帮助用户识别性能瓶颈。

sysbench:一款多线程基准测试工具,可以用于测试数据库的CPU、内存和I/O性能。

3. 配置评估工具

chkconfig:用于检查和配置Linux系统服务的工具,可以确保数据库服务正确启动。

dpkg:Debian包管理工具,可以用于检查数据库软件的安装和配置情况。

数据库评估的步骤

使用Kali Linux进行数据库评估通常包括以下步骤:

1. 信息收集

使用Nmap等工具扫描网络,发现并识别数据库服务器,通过识别数据库的类型和版本,可以为后续的评估工作提供基础信息。

2. 安全性检测

使用SQLMap、Metasploit等工具进行SQL注入、弱密码等安全漏洞的检测,重点关注数据库的认证机制、访问控制和数据加密等方面。

3. 性能测试

使用sysbench、MySQLtuner等工具进行数据库的性能测试,分析响应时间、吞吐量等关键指标,找出性能瓶颈。

4. 配置检查

使用chkconfig、dpkg等工具检查数据库的配置参数,确保其符合最佳实践,重点关注内存分配、连接池设置、日志管理等配置项。

5. 报告生成

将评估结果整理成报告,详细描述发现的问题和改进建议,为后续的修复和优化工作提供依据。

最佳实践

在进行数据库评估时,以下是一些值得遵循的最佳实践:

1、定期评估:数据库环境和应用场景不断变化,定期评估可以及时发现新出现的问题。

2、综合评估:不仅要关注安全性,还要关注性能和配置,进行全面评估。

3、自动化工具与手动检查结合:自动化工具可以提高效率,但手动检查可以发现一些工具无法识别的问题。

4、及时修复:发现问题和漏洞后,应及时采取措施进行修复,避免潜在风险

5、文档记录:评估过程和结果应详细记录,便于后续的复查和改进。

案例分析

以下是一个使用Kali Linux进行数据库评估的案例:

某企业使用MySQL数据库存储关键业务数据,近期发现系统响应变慢,怀疑存在性能问题,安全团队决定使用Kali Linux进行全面的数据库评估。

1、信息收集:使用Nmap扫描网络,发现MySQL服务器运行在192.168.1.100上,版本为5.7.30。

2、安全性检测:使用SQLMap进行SQL注入检测,未发现注入漏洞;使用Metasploit进行弱密码检测,发现root账户密码过于简单。

3、性能测试:使用sysbench进行基准测试,发现数据库的写入性能较差;使用MySQLtuner进行分析,建议调整innodb_buffer_pool_size参数。

4、配置检查:使用dpkg检查MySQL安装情况,发现部分配置文件未按最佳实践设置。

5、报告生成:整理评估结果,提出修复弱密码、优化innodb_buffer_pool_size参数、调整配置文件等建议。

通过评估和优化,该企业的数据库性能得到了显著提升,安全性也得到了加强。

Kali Linux作为一款强大的安全测试工具,在数据库评估中发挥着重要作用,通过综合运用其提供的工具和资源,用户可以全面评估数据库的安全性和性能,及时发现和修复潜在问题,确保数据库的稳定运行,在实际应用中,遵循最佳实践,定期进行评估,是保障数据库安全性和性能的关键。

相关关键词

Kali Linux, 数据库评估, 安全性检测, 性能测试, 配置检查, SQLMap, Nmap, Metasploit, MySQLtuner, pgBadger, sysbench, chkconfig, dpkg, 信息收集, 漏洞扫描, 弱密码检测, 基准测试, 性能优化, 配置参数, 最佳实践, 渗透测试, 数字取证, 数据库安全, 数据库性能, MySQL, PostgreSQL, Debian, 自动化工具, 手动检查, 评估报告, 问题修复, 风险管理, 网络扫描, 版本识别, 认证机制, 访问控制, 数据加密, 内存分配, 连接池设置, 日志管理, 定期评估, 综合评估, 文档记录, 案例分析, 业务数据, 系统响应, 安全团队, 安装情况, 优化建议, 稳定运行, 安全测试工具, 数据库服务器, 攻击模块, 性能调优, I/O性能, 多线程测试, 安全漏洞, 性能瓶颈, 配置文件, 参数调整, 弱密码, SQL注入, 数据库接管, 网络安全, 数据保护, 系统优化, 安全配置, 性能指标, 响应时间, 吞吐量, 安全风险, 数据库管理, 安全策略, 性能分析, 配置优化, 安全评估, 性能评估工具, 数据库安全评估, 数据库性能评估

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

Kali Linux数据库评估:kali启动数据库

原文链接:,转发请注明来源!